News App Project: Report & PDF Guide

by Admin 37 views
News App Project: Report & PDF Guide

Hey guys! Let's dive into the exciting world of news app projects. This report acts like your ultimate guide, especially if you're looking for a project report in PDF form. We'll cover everything, from the initial concept to the nitty-gritty details of development, design, and all the important stuff. Think of it as a comprehensive roadmap to building your own awesome news app. We'll explore the key components, the challenges you might face, and the solutions to overcome them. Plus, we'll talk about how to create a top-notch news app project report PDF. So, whether you're a student working on a project or a developer looking for inspiration, stick around. This is going to be a fun and informative ride! We're talking about a news app project report PDF that is well-structured and easy to understand. We'll also consider how to present the information effectively. We will consider the key sections and how to best organize them. Remember, a good project report showcases your skills and knowledge, and the PDF format is perfect for sharing and presenting your work. Ready to get started? Let's go! I am here to help you understand every aspect of your project report PDF.

We start with understanding the basics of a news app. A news app is designed to deliver news content to users on their mobile devices. It offers a convenient way for people to stay informed on the go. News app project report PDF will explore the different features that can be included. This is to make sure your app is engaging and easy to use. The app typically includes a variety of news articles, categorized by topics like politics, sports, business, and technology. Users can easily browse, search, and personalize their news feed. This feature allows them to tailor their experience to their interests. Push notifications are another crucial aspect of news apps. It alerts users about breaking news or important updates. News apps need to support multimedia content, such as images and videos. The design should be user-friendly with an intuitive interface. A good news app provides a great user experience with fast loading times and smooth navigation. You will also see how the development process works and what to expect when you're building a news app project. Our goal is to equip you with the knowledge to make your news app project a success. We'll analyze existing news apps and identify what makes them successful. We will also look at the different technologies and tools that can be used to develop a news app. So, you can build a project report in PDF form and you can get all the insights you need.

Project Planning and Requirements

Alright, so you're building a news app project report PDF? Sweet! The first step is all about planning. Let's break down the essential components to make sure your news app project is a success. First up: Gathering Requirements. Before you start coding, you gotta know what you're building. This means understanding exactly what your app will do. Identify Features: Think about what makes a great news app. Do you want to include categories, search, or breaking news alerts? How about user profiles or the ability to share articles on social media? Make a list of all the features you plan to include. The more detailed your feature list, the better. Your news app project report PDF should reflect this. This includes the functional requirements. Then, you'll need the non-functional requirements. These are things like performance, security, and usability. It's about what the user will see and experience when they are using the app. Make sure your app is fast and easy to navigate. Target Audience: Who are you building this app for? Understanding your target audience is super important. Are you targeting young people, professionals, or a general audience? Competitive Analysis: Check out what other news apps are doing. What are their strengths and weaknesses? This helps you understand your market and identify areas where your app can stand out. This part of your news app project report PDF will look at the design and user interface (UI) of the news app. You will explore a design that's user-friendly and aesthetically pleasing. Wireframes and mockups will help you visualize the layout and design of your app. This way, you can create a smooth and engaging user experience.

We will consider the layout and design for different devices. You can use tools such as Figma or Adobe XD to create wireframes. These are basic visual representations of the app's structure and layout. You will then move to mockups. Mockups are more detailed and visually rich representations of the app’s design. This will help you get a better idea of how the app will look and feel. The Technical Design section of the report describes the technical architecture of the news app. This includes the programming languages, frameworks, and technologies used. Decide the platform you will use to build your app. Will it be iOS, Android, or both? This will influence the technologies you choose. You can use platforms like React Native or Flutter. These allow you to build apps for both iOS and Android. Your news app project report PDF should cover the architecture of your app. Break down the components. Consider using a diagram to showcase how the different parts of the app interact. Make sure to choose the right database and consider the security measures you will take. This is how you design a good app.

Development Process and Technologies

Now, let's talk about the fun part: development! This is where your news app comes to life. In your news app project report PDF, you'll want to describe the development process step-by-step. Let's start with choosing the right tech stack. For mobile app development, you can go native (Swift for iOS, Kotlin/Java for Android) or use cross-platform frameworks like React Native or Flutter. Native development offers better performance and access to device features, while cross-platform allows you to write code once and deploy it on both platforms. It's all about finding the perfect mix! Then, you need an integrated development environment (IDE). Popular choices include Xcode (for iOS), Android Studio (for Android), and Visual Studio Code (for cross-platform).

Next, API Integration. News apps rely heavily on APIs to fetch data. You'll need to integrate APIs from news providers. Research the available APIs and their documentation. Make sure they meet your requirements in terms of content and format. In your news app project report PDF, document the API endpoints you're using. Explain how you're handling data retrieval and parsing. Database Design: A well-designed database is essential for storing user data, article content, and app settings. Consider what you need to store. Choose a database like Firebase, MongoDB, or PostgreSQL. Plan the database schema carefully. This should include the tables, fields, and relationships. It is also important to consider the security of your app and the protection of user data. Include steps to secure your app. This will help you protect user data from unauthorized access. The section on coding standards is a critical aspect. It ensures that the code is readable, maintainable, and scalable. Document your code clearly. This will make it easier for others to understand. Now comes testing and debugging. Testing is a must! In your news app project report PDF, detail your testing strategy. This includes unit tests, integration tests, and user acceptance testing (UAT). Describe the testing tools and techniques you'll use. Keep a log of bugs. These need to be fixed to ensure the app works smoothly. Debugging is part of the deal. Use debugging tools to identify and fix errors.

UI/UX Design and Implementation

Alright, let's focus on making your news app look and feel amazing. In your news app project report PDF, the UI/UX design section is super important. Start with a solid UI Design. This is about the visual elements of your app. Decide on the color scheme, typography, and overall look and feel of your app. Use tools like Figma or Adobe XD to create mockups of your app's screens. Make sure your design is consistent across all screens. This makes the user experience smoother. It's time to build a fantastic user experience (UX). The UX is how users interact with your app. Think about how easy it is to navigate, find content, and use all the features. Do your research on what makes a great user experience. Make sure your app is easy to use and intuitive.

Then, you should focus on User Interface Elements. These include buttons, icons, and menus. Make sure they are well-designed and easy to use. Navigation: Plan how users will move through the app. A clear navigation structure is key to a good user experience. Design the navigation to be intuitive. Usability Testing: Test your app with real users. Get feedback on how they use your app. Use the feedback to improve the design. Feedback and Iteration: You're never really done with the UI/UX. Be prepared to make changes based on user feedback. In your news app project report PDF, you should include a section about the development and implementation. Discuss the coding languages, frameworks, and tools used to create your app. You may also want to talk about how you integrated the UI design into your code. Include the steps for creating the app and integrating the design into the app. Now, for the final touches! It's time to add the finishing touches. Focus on the details and make your app polished. Make sure everything works smoothly. This will provide a great experience for the user.

Project Report PDF Structure and Content

Let's get your news app project report PDF in tip-top shape. First, the basic structure: a well-organized PDF is super important! Start with a title page. Include your project title, your name, date, and any relevant information. This is where you make a great first impression. Then, your table of contents. This helps readers navigate your report easily. Use clear headings and subheadings. Then, your introduction. Give a brief overview of your project. State your goals and what you aim to achieve. Why did you create the app? Your requirements analysis. Detail the features, functionality, and the target audience. The next step is the design and architecture. Describe the UI/UX design, database design, and overall architecture. Add the development process. Explain the technologies and the development steps. Include a testing and debugging section. Detail your testing methods and results. Your results and discussion. Present your findings. Talk about the challenges, achievements, and future improvements. Then, the conclusion. Summarize your project and lessons learned. Finish with a bibliography and references. List all sources you used. Don't forget any appendices! These can include screenshots, code snippets, or any additional details. Use clear and concise language. Use headings, subheadings, and bullet points to organize your content. Include diagrams, flowcharts, and screenshots to illustrate your points. Make sure to use professional fonts and formatting. Stick to a consistent style throughout your report. Check for errors. Proofread your report carefully before submitting it. You want your report to be error-free.

Testing, Deployment, and Future Enhancements

Now, let's talk about testing, deployment, and future improvements. Testing is your best friend. In your news app project report PDF, detail the testing process. Perform unit tests to test individual components. Conduct integration tests to ensure different parts of your app work together. Don't forget user acceptance testing (UAT). You want to ensure the users are happy with your app. Document all testing procedures, the results, and any bugs found. Then, document the fixes. After testing comes Deployment. Where and how will users access your app? If it is a mobile app, you'll need to submit it to the App Store or Google Play Store. Follow their guidelines and documentation. Include the deployment process in your news app project report PDF, including screenshots and timelines.

Next, Future Enhancements. What's next for your app? Identify potential features, improvements, and updates. This might include adding new content, improving the user experience, or integrating new technologies. Outline these in your news app project report PDF. Consider also Scalability and Performance. Discuss how your app handles a large number of users. Make sure your app is fast and reliable. What steps did you take to optimize its performance? You can include the scalability of the backend and any caching mechanisms. Add a section on Maintenance and Updates. Discuss how you will maintain and update your app. This can include fixing bugs, adding new features, and keeping your app secure. The news app project report PDF should cover all of these sections. This is the last part of your report. You should consider the project's sustainability and long-term viability. By the end of this stage, you've created a fully functional news app. This report shows off your hard work and know-how.

Conclusion

In conclusion, we've walked through the key elements of a news app project report PDF. You now have a solid foundation for creating a comprehensive and compelling report. Remember, the news app project report PDF is not just a document; it's a testament to your skills, your knowledge, and your ability to bring an idea to life. Good luck, and have fun building your app! I wish you success in your project! Hopefully, this information helps you in creating a high-quality project report! Always remember to keep learning and experimenting. This is how you will improve your skills as a developer and project manager. I hope this helps you build an awesome news app! Good luck, guys!